Photo by Chris Tanouye/Getty Images The 2022 second-rounder was in the OHL this season. The Chicago Blackhawks added another prospect to the organization on Saturday morning, signing 2022 second-round pick (39th overall) Paul Ludwinski to a three-year, entry-level contract. Please Take Me Away From Here: Wild 3, Blackhawks 1
Bruce Fedyck-USA TODAY Sports Counting down the days until the end of the season. After allowing a tie-breaking goal in the waning minutes of the third period, the Chicago Blackhawks fell 3-1 to the Minnesota Wild on Saturday in St. Paul.
